This test provides long term detector sensitivity measurement for the 4 HSP IDT detectors. The test measures the sensitivity of the IDT's to light from two calibration targets. Two targets are chosen to establish a calibration to existing HSP data. The program collects area scan data on both the finding aperture and a F240W aperture for the UV1 and VIS detectors, an F248M filter for the UV2 detector and for a F327M filter on the POL detector. Data will be collected every two months to provide a calibration of detector sensitivity as a function of time.
